|
xrootd
|
#include <XrdCryptosslFactory.hh>


| XrdCryptosslFactory::XrdCryptosslFactory | ( | ) |
References EPNAME, XrdSutRndm::GetBuffer(), SetTrace(), sslfactory_id_callback(), sslfactory_lock(), SSLFACTORY_MAX_CRYPTO_MUTEX, and TRACE.
| virtual XrdCryptosslFactory::~XrdCryptosslFactory | ( | ) | [inline, virtual] |
| XrdCryptoCipher * XrdCryptosslFactory::Cipher | ( | const char * | t, |
| int | l = 0 |
||
| ) | [virtual] |
Reimplemented from XrdCryptoFactory.
References XrdCryptoCipher::IsValid().
| XrdCryptoCipher * XrdCryptosslFactory::Cipher | ( | int | bits, |
| char * | pub, | ||
| int | lpub, | ||
| const char * | t = 0 |
||
| ) | [virtual] |
Reimplemented from XrdCryptoFactory.
References XrdCryptoCipher::IsValid().
| XrdCryptoCipher * XrdCryptosslFactory::Cipher | ( | const XrdCryptoCipher & | c | ) | [virtual] |
Reimplemented from XrdCryptoFactory.
References XrdCryptoCipher::IsValid().
| XrdCryptoCipher * XrdCryptosslFactory::Cipher | ( | const char * | t, |
| int | l, | ||
| const char * | k, | ||
| int | liv, | ||
| const char * | iv | ||
| ) | [virtual] |
Reimplemented from XrdCryptoFactory.
References XrdCryptoCipher::IsValid().
| XrdCryptoCipher * XrdCryptosslFactory::Cipher | ( | XrdSutBucket * | b | ) | [virtual] |
Reimplemented from XrdCryptoFactory.
References XrdCryptoCipher::IsValid().
| XrdCryptoKDFun_t XrdCryptosslFactory::KDFun | ( | ) | [virtual] |
Reimplemented from XrdCryptoFactory.
References XrdCryptosslKDFun().
| XrdCryptoKDFunLen_t XrdCryptosslFactory::KDFunLen | ( | ) | [virtual] |
Reimplemented from XrdCryptoFactory.
References XrdCryptosslKDFunLen().
| XrdCryptoMsgDigest * XrdCryptosslFactory::MsgDigest | ( | const char * | dgst | ) | [virtual] |
Reimplemented from XrdCryptoFactory.
References XrdCryptoMsgDigest::IsValid().
| XrdCryptoRSA * XrdCryptosslFactory::RSA | ( | int | bits = XrdCryptoDefRSABits, |
| int | exp = XrdCryptoDefRSAExp |
||
| ) | [virtual] |
Reimplemented from XrdCryptoFactory.
References XrdCryptoRSA::IsValid().
| XrdCryptoRSA * XrdCryptosslFactory::RSA | ( | const char * | pub, |
| int | lpub = 0 |
||
| ) | [virtual] |
Reimplemented from XrdCryptoFactory.
References XrdCryptoRSA::IsValid().
| XrdCryptoRSA * XrdCryptosslFactory::RSA | ( | const XrdCryptoRSA & | r | ) | [virtual] |
Reimplemented from XrdCryptoFactory.
References XrdCryptoRSA::IsValid().
| void XrdCryptosslFactory::SetTrace | ( | kXR_int32 | trace | ) | [virtual] |
Reimplemented from XrdCryptoFactory.
References eDest, XrdSysError::logger(), sslTRACE_ALL, sslTRACE_Debug, sslTRACE_Dump, sslTRACE_Notify, and XrdOucTrace::What.
Referenced by XrdCryptosslFactory().
| bool XrdCryptosslFactory::SupportedCipher | ( | const char * | t | ) | [virtual] |
Reimplemented from XrdCryptoFactory.
References XrdCryptosslCipher::IsSupported().
| bool XrdCryptosslFactory::SupportedMsgDigest | ( | const char * | dgst | ) | [virtual] |
Reimplemented from XrdCryptoFactory.
References XrdCryptosslMsgDigest::IsSupported().
| XrdCryptoX509 * XrdCryptosslFactory::X509 | ( | XrdSutBucket * | b | ) | [virtual] |
Reimplemented from XrdCryptoFactory.
References XrdCryptoX509::Opaque().
| XrdCryptoX509 * XrdCryptosslFactory::X509 | ( | const char * | cf, |
| const char * | kf = 0 |
||
| ) | [virtual] |
Reimplemented from XrdCryptoFactory.
References XrdCryptoX509::Opaque().
| XrdCryptoX509ChainToFile_t XrdCryptosslFactory::X509ChainToFile | ( | ) | [virtual] |
Reimplemented from XrdCryptoFactory.
References XrdCryptosslX509ChainToFile().
| XrdCryptoX509Crl * XrdCryptosslFactory::X509Crl | ( | XrdCryptoX509 * | cacert | ) | [virtual] |
Reimplemented from XrdCryptoFactory.
References XrdCryptoX509Crl::Opaque().
| XrdCryptoX509Crl * XrdCryptosslFactory::X509Crl | ( | const char * | crlfile, |
| int | opt = 0 |
||
| ) | [virtual] |
Reimplemented from XrdCryptoFactory.
References XrdCryptoX509Crl::Opaque().
| XrdCryptoX509ExportChain_t XrdCryptosslFactory::X509ExportChain | ( | ) | [virtual] |
Reimplemented from XrdCryptoFactory.
References XrdCryptosslX509ExportChain().
| XrdCryptoX509ParseBucket_t XrdCryptosslFactory::X509ParseBucket | ( | ) | [virtual] |
Reimplemented from XrdCryptoFactory.
References XrdCryptosslX509ParseBucket().
| XrdCryptoX509ParseFile_t XrdCryptosslFactory::X509ParseFile | ( | ) | [virtual] |
Reimplemented from XrdCryptoFactory.
References XrdCryptosslX509ParseFile().
| XrdCryptoX509Req * XrdCryptosslFactory::X509Req | ( | XrdSutBucket * | bck | ) | [virtual] |
Reimplemented from XrdCryptoFactory.
References XrdCryptoX509Req::Opaque().
| XrdCryptoX509VerifyCert_t XrdCryptosslFactory::X509VerifyCert | ( | ) | [virtual] |
Reimplemented from XrdCryptoFactory.
References XrdCryptosslX509VerifyCert().
| XrdCryptoX509VerifyChain_t XrdCryptosslFactory::X509VerifyChain | ( | ) | [virtual] |
Reimplemented from XrdCryptoFactory.
References XrdCryptosslX509VerifyChain().
XrdSysMutex * XrdCryptosslFactory::CryptoMutexPool [static] |
1.7.3